if you have a volume of 55 L and a density of 2 kg/L, what is the mass?

Respuesta :

oladipupog80
oladipupog80 oladipupog80
  • 19-02-2020

Answer:

110kg

Explanation:

Density = mass / volume

Mass = density x volume

Given

Density = 2kg/l

Volume = 55l

Mass = 2kg/l x 55l

Mass = 110 kg
